Understanding Weight and Units



Weight is a measure of the force of gravity acting on an object's mass. While mass remains constant, weight can change depending on the gravitational pull. The pound (lb) and the kilogram (kg) are both units of weight, but they belong to different systems of measurement. The pound is a unit in the imperial system, primarily used in the United States and a few other countries, while the kilogram is the base unit of mass in the International System of Units (SI), the most widely used system globally. Understanding this distinction is crucial for accurate conversions.


The Conversion Factor: Pounds to Kilograms



The key to converting pounds to kilograms is the conversion factor. One kilogram is approximately equal to 2.20462 pounds. This means that there are fewer kilograms than pounds for any given weight. Therefore, to convert pounds to kilograms, we need to divide the weight in pounds by the conversion factor.

Mathematically, the formula is:

Kilograms (kg) = Pounds (lb) / 2.20462


Converting 400 Pounds to Kilograms



Applying the formula to our target weight of 400 pounds, we get:

Kilograms (kg) = 400 lb / 2.20462 kg/lb

Kilograms (kg) ≈ 181.437 kg

Therefore, 400 pounds is approximately equal to 181.44 kilograms. It's important to note that we've rounded the result to two decimal places for practicality. For extremely precise applications, you may need to use more decimal places or a more precise conversion factor.

1. Is the conversion factor 2.20462 exact?

No, it's an approximation. The exact conversion factor is a non-terminating decimal. The level of precision required will dictate how many decimal places you use.

2. Can I use an online converter instead of calculating manually?

Yes, many online converters are available for quick and easy conversions. These tools are convenient but understanding the underlying principle remains crucial.

3. What if I need to convert kilograms to pounds?

The reverse conversion is done by multiplying the weight in kilograms by 2.20462. Pounds (lb) = Kilograms (kg) 2.20462
